Table 6.
Total Se content
| SA (mg/L) | Root (mg/kg DW) | Stem (mg/kg DW) | Leaf (mg/kg DW) | Shoot (mg/kg DW)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 0 | 25.85 ± 0.28b | 2.618 ± 0.035d | 1.672 ± 0.045d | 1.839 ± 0.050e |
| 100 | 25.22 ± 0.93b | 2.877 ± 0.098c | 1.949 ± 0.020c | 2.111 ± 0.018d |
| 150 | 25.74 ± 0.70b | 3.249 ± 0.050b | 2.000 ± 0.055c | 2.231 ± 0.050c |
| 200 | 26.02 ± 0.89b | 3.793 ± 0.049a | 2.362 ± 0.062b | 2.622 ± 0.060b |
| 250 | 28.54 ± 0.91a | 3.825 ± 0.077a | 2.716 ± 0.080a | 2.914 ± 0.061a |
Values are means (± SE) of four replicates. Significant differences (indicated by different lowercase letters) within a column are based on a one-way analysis of variance with least significant difference (p < 0.05). DW = dry weight. Se content in shoots = (Se content in stems × stem biomass + Se content in leaves × leaf biomass)/ shoot biomass
